While most cars are different there's usually some cable or link from the handle to the latch where the seat latches to the bottom part.   Tilt the seat forward and usually there's a two part "jaws" arrangement that opens with the latch handle and closes when it hits the "pin" in the bottom section.    May just be jammed do use a large screwdriver or lever to unpry the jaws while the latch is held up.    Jiggle it at the same time.   Chances are it's a cable that's out of adjustment requiring lube or adjustment.    If you're luck though you can oil/grease the jaws and work the oil in to get it working good enough.
